Transaction 2bc0dfda17096816a74ca052dfc56c01b8432e749af11b361f0c525f1d85478b
1 Input
1 Output
-
2bc0dfda17096816a74ca052dfc56c01b8432e749af11b361f0c525f1d85478b:0
- value
- 676288
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f5803a69588160f3338882bd46cac5e065fd9d6 OP_EQUAL
- address
- 3K8kRXCFFr2k6Yux9LF7f1bhXfg5zz9sjW